According to the CDP Institute, a CDP is "packaged software application that creates a consistent, unified client database that is available to other systems (create a single)." The CDP is the option where all of your client and prospect data comes together consisting of both structured information (e.

CRM, marketing automation, loyalty, etc.) and disorganized data (e. g. cdp marketing. behavioral, contextual, intent, and so on). Lots of other options will gather and store client data within your company, but the CDP is suggested to be the central system where you create one single and total photo of every individual. This suggests that your CDP needs to be able to take in data from several sources (in addition to information it tracks natively), produce insights from all that data, and have the ability to pass data and insights out to other systems too.

The obstacle is that customer data goes into the CDP from various systems, which all store information in their own methods in their own profiles. customer data platform features. Hence, all of the data about an individual should be stitched together within the CDP to produce thorough private profiles. comprehensive view. Most CDPs can do this either through deterministic matching stitching profiles together based upon a clear, typical identifier (such as e-mail address, user ID, loyalty program number, etc.) or probabilistic/heuristic matching making an informed guess about which profiles represent the very same person based upon habits, area, comparable information, etc (data warehouses).
